Week Six Men's Power Rankings

Six weeks into the season, SBL.asn.au writer Jacob Kagi evaluates where each team is at, including looking at the teams most likely to rise from a slow start or drop down the ladder in the coming weeks.

1. Lakeside Lightning (2nd place, 6-1 record) - Despite the prolonged absence of star forward Ben Beran, the Lightning have won three straight since losing to Willetton. Will be difficult to beat when at full-strength, but face a tough test this weekend against Cockburn.

2. Cockburn Cougars (1st, 7-1) - Easily the surprise packets of the season, the Cougars bounced back with an important 10-point win over Perth. Will strengthen their title credentials further with victory against Lakeside.

3. SKILLED Goldfields Giants (4th, 5-3) - The Giants are on a roll, having won five of their last six, including wins over top eight sides Rockingham and Perth last weekend. Should consolidate their top four spot with a win over the Slammers on Saturday.

4. Southlands Boulevarde Willetton Tigers (8th, 4-4) - Have recovered from a slow start to win three of their last four and appear to be back on track. When Matt Knight and Cam Tovey return the Tigers should be among the elite teams.

5. Wanneroo Wolves (3rd, 6-3) - Suffered a blow with a tough loss to Willetton last round, but have a good chance to bounce back when they host the Senators on Saturday.

6. Perth Redbacks (5th, 5-4) - Have lost three of their last four games and appear to be taking time to gel, but should still be considered a legitimate title contender with Jesse Wagstaff expected to return in the next few weeks.

7. Sun City Plumbing Geraldton Buccaneers (9th, 4-4) - Geraldton have finally found some form with three straight wins and appear to be finally gelling. Can send a real statement to the league with victory over Perry Lakes on Saturday.

8. Total Connections Perry Lakes Hawks (7th, 4-4) - Another side searching for consistency, as shown by the way they backed up their win over Cockburn with a loss to East Perth. Have the potential to beat anyone on their day though.

9. Rockingham Flames (6th, 4-3) - Have fallen back to earth with defeats in three of their previous four games but have a golden chance to get back into form when they face local rivals Mandurah on Friday.

10. Australian Central East Perth Eagles (10th, 4-5) - Have been inconsistent but showed what they're capable of with their impressive victory over the Hawks last round.

11. ATD Stirling Senators (11th, 3-4) - The Senators provided a tough challenge to Lakeside on the weekend and had won three of their previous four before then. Could shoot right up in the rankings if Lee Roberts' hot form continues.

12. Mandurah Magic (12th, 2-6) - With Taylor Mullenax's late arrival and Casey Crevelone's injury, Mandurah hasn't been at full strength all season and has struggled as a result. Must improve immediately to keep their finals hopes alive.

13. Kalamunda Eastern Suns (13th, 2-6) - The Suns have lost five straight and will have to turn it around quickly to maintain any hope of making the top eight.

14. Southwest Slammers (14th, 0-8) - It appears likely to be another long season for the Slammers but have come close in a few of their recent matches and should break through for a win soon.
